Market Insights

Bitcoin (BTC) and ether (ETH) are encountering pressure as recent gains evaporate following comments from Federal Reserve Chairman Jerome Powell, who mitigated concerns regarding inflation caused by tariffs.

Upcoming Events

  • March 20, 9:30 a.m.: First-ever CFTC-regulated XRP futures to debut by Bitnomial.
  • March 20, 10:40 a.m.: President Trump scheduled to address the Digital Asset Summit in New York.

Trump is likely to advocate for making the U.S. the “crypto capital of the world.”
Translation: He may express his desire for the U.S. to lead in cryptocurrency initiatives.

More positive momentum appears around U.S.-listed spot ETFs, with bitcoin ETFs recording net inflows totaling $11.8 million recently, marking four days of consecutive growth, while ether ETFs have seen outflows continue for eleven days.

What’s New?

Emerging interest in frog-themed tokens soared recently after Elon Musk referenced them on social media, triggering market movements.
